2018年3月27日

lua 中处理cocos2dx 的button 事件

摘要: 1、引入这个类:require "GuiConstants" 2、下面是回调函数的处理. local function menuZhuCeCallback(sender,eventType) print(sender:getTag()) if eventType == ccui.TouchEvent 阅读全文

posted @ 2018-03-27 11:15 echo111333 阅读(358) 评论(0) 推荐(0) 编辑

lua注册事件函数

摘要: registerScriptTouchHandler 注册触屏事件 registerScriptTapHandler 注册点击事件 registerScriptHandler 注册基本事件 包括 触屏 层的进入 退出 事件 registerScriptKeypadHandler 注册键盘事件 reg 阅读全文

posted @ 2018-03-27 10:59 echo111333 阅读(501) 评论(0) 推荐(0) 编辑

cocos2dx-lua捕获用户touch事件的几种方式

摘要: 1.为每个关心的事件注册回调函数 具体分为以下几种 1>单点触摸 注册函数为 cc.Handler.EVENT_TOUCH_BEGAN = 40 cc.Handler.EVENT_TOUCH_MOVED = 41 cc.Handler.EVENT_TOUCH_ENDED = 42 cc.Handle 阅读全文

posted @ 2018-03-27 10:49 echo111333 阅读(565) 评论(0) 推荐(0) 编辑

Cocos2d-x 吞没事件:setSwallowTouches

摘要: 使用:给触摸监听函数设置吞没事件,使得触摸上面的层的时候事件不会向下传递 方式:listener->setSwallowTouches(true),不向下触摸 简单点来说,比如有两个sprite ,A 和 B,A在上B在下(位置重叠),触摸A的时候,B不会受到影响 今天在一个场景上添加布景层laye 阅读全文

posted @ 2018-03-27 10:23 echo111333 阅读(4655) 评论(0) 推荐(0) 编辑

导航